Home
last modified time | relevance | path

Searched refs:buffer_get (Results 1 – 20 of 20) sorted by relevance

/external/coreboot/util/cbfstool/
Difwitool.c592 struct bpdt *b = buffer_get(&ifwi_image.bpdt); in find_entry_by_type()
603 b = buffer_get(&ifwi_image.subpart_buf[S_BPDT_TYPE]); in find_entry_by_type()
690 memcpy(buffer_get(buf), (uint8_t *)data + e[i].offset, in read_subpart_buf()
712 struct bpdt *bpdt = buffer_get(b); in alloc_bpdt_buffer()
803 uint8_t *data = buffer_get(input_buf); in parse_subpart_dir()
825 memcpy(buffer_get(subpart_dir_buf), &hdr, SUBPART_DIR_HEADER_SIZE); in parse_subpart_dir()
828 struct subpart_dir *subpart_dir = buffer_get(subpart_dir_buf); in parse_subpart_dir()
876 void *data = buffer_get(buff); in ifwi_parse()
936 memcpy(buffer_get(&temp), buffer_get(b), buffer_size(b)); in __bpdt_reset()
941 struct bpdt *bpdt = buffer_get(b); in __bpdt_reset()
[all …]
Dplatform_fixups.c55 hashtable = buffer_get(&elf) + ph->p_offset; in qualcomm_find_hash()
70 if (vb2_hash_calculate(false, buffer_get(&elf) + pelf.phdr[bb_segment].p_offset, in qualcomm_find_hash()
149 data_size = read_le32(buffer_get(&buffer) + 32); in mediatek_find_hash()
162 if (vb2_hash_calculate(false, buffer_get(&buffer), in mediatek_find_hash()
170 return buffer_get(&buffer); in mediatek_find_hash()
Delogtool.c97 if (elog_verify_header(buffer_get(buffer)) != CB_SUCCESS) { in elog_read()
139 event = buffer_get(iter); in next_available_event_offset()
168 data = buffer_get(buf); in shrink_buffer()
172 event = buffer_get(iter); in shrink_buffer()
206 event = buffer_get(buf) + sizeof(struct elog_header); in cmd_list()
244 memset(buffer_get(&copy), ELOG_TYPE_EOL, buffer_size(&copy)); in cmd_clear()
Dcse_helpers.c10 void *dst = buffer_get(buff); in write_member()
35 const void *src = buffer_get(buff); in read_member()
Dcbfstool.c180 buffer_get(&cbfs.buffer); in get_mh_cache()
186 struct metadata_hash_anchor *anchor = memmem(buffer_get(&buffer) + offset, in get_mh_cache()
195 mhc.offset = (void *)anchor - buffer_get(&buffer); in get_mh_cache()
224 struct metadata_hash_anchor *anchor = buffer_get(&buffer) + mhc->offset; in update_anchor()
769 offset = buffer_get(param.image_region) - in cbfs_add_master_header()
793 buffer_get(&image.buffer); in cbfs_add_master_header()
796 h_loc = (void *)(buffer_get(&image.buffer) + in cbfs_add_master_header()
844 memcpy(buffer_get(&bb1), buffer_get(buffer), bb_buf_size); in add_topswap_bootblock()
846 memcpy(buffer_get(&bb2), buffer_get(buffer), bb_buf_size); in add_topswap_bootblock()
1139 memcpy(buffer_get(&fsp), buffer_get(buffer), buffer_size(buffer)); in cbfstool_convert_fsp()
[all …]
Dcbfs_image.c368 dst_entry = (struct cbfs_file *)buffer_get(dst); in cbfs_copy_instance()
386 if ((size_t)((uint8_t *)dst_entry - (uint8_t *)buffer_get(dst)) in cbfs_copy_instance()
398 ((uint8_t *)dst_entry - (uint8_t *)buffer_get(dst)) - in cbfs_copy_instance()
412 if (buffer_get(region) == NULL) in cbfs_expand_to_region()
425 for (entry = buffer_get(region); in cbfs_expand_to_region()
436 ((uint8_t *)entry - (uint8_t *)buffer_get(region)) - in cbfs_expand_to_region()
453 if (buffer_get(region) == NULL) in cbfs_truncate_space()
464 for (trailer = entry = buffer_get(region); in cbfs_truncate_space()
480 *size = (uint8_t *)entry - (uint8_t *)buffer_get(region); in cbfs_truncate_space()
483 *size = (uint8_t *)trailer - (uint8_t *)buffer_get(region); in cbfs_truncate_space()
[all …]
Dcse_serger.c409 memcpy(buffer_get(buff) + e->offset, buffer_get(s_buff), e->size); in subpart_write()
636 void *data = buffer_get(buff); in allocate_buffer()
707 memset(buffer_get(&cse_buff), 0xff, buffer_size(&cse_buff)); in cmd_create_cse_region()
708 memcpy(buffer_get(&cse_buff), buffer_get(&layout_buff), buffer_size(&layout_buff)); in cmd_create_cse_region()
734 memcpy(buffer_get(&wbuff), buffer_get(&rbuff), buffer_size(&rbuff)); in cmd_create_cse_region()
Dcbfs-payload-linux.c112 char *input = buffer_get(in); in bzp_add_kernel()
166 bzp->compress(buffer_get(b), buffer_size(b), buffer_get(&out), &len); in bzp_output_segment()
Dcbfs_glue.h19 memcpy(buffer, buffer_get(&dev->buffer) + offset, size); in cbfs_dev_read()
Dcommon.h41 static inline void *buffer_get(const struct buffer *b) in buffer_get() function
124 return buffer_get(b) - buffer_offset(b); in buffer_get_original_backing()
Dcbfs-mkstage.c75 shstrtab = buffer_get(pelf->strtabs[pelf->ehdr.e_shstrndx]); in find_ignored_sections_header()
380 memset(buffer_get(&boutput), 0, filesz); in parse_elf_to_xip_stage()
398 bputs(&boutput, buffer_get(&binput), (*phdr)->p_filesz); in parse_elf_to_xip_stage()
Dcbfs-mkpayload.c370 fdt_h = buffer_get(input); in parse_fit_to_payload()
392 memcpy(buffer_get(output), buffer_get(input), buffer_size(input)); in parse_fit_to_payload()
Dcse_fpt.c80 const uint8_t *data = buffer_get(input_buff); in get_fpt_buff()
Drmodule.c295 shstrtab = buffer_get(pelf->strtabs[pelf->ehdr.e_shstrndx]); in filter_relocation_sections()
718 ctx->strtab = buffer_get(pelf->strtabs[i]); in rmodule_init()
Deventlog.c725 event = buffer_get(buf); in eventlog_init_event()
Delfheaders.c496 if (!iself(buffer_get(pinput))) { in parse_elf()
1235 bputs(&data, buffer_get(&sec->content), in elf_writer_serialize()
/external/coreboot/util/cbfstool/fpt_formats/
Dfpt_hdr_20.c20 const uint8_t *data = buffer_get(buff); in match_version()
Dfpt_hdr_21.c27 const uint8_t *data = buffer_get(buff); in match_version()
/external/coreboot/util/cbfstool/bpdt_formats/
Dbpdt_1_6.c40 const uint8_t *data = buffer_get(buff); in match_version()
Dbpdt_1_7.c52 const uint8_t *data = buffer_get(buff); in match_version()